What’s a ‘bender’?

A real human being who bends glass tubes in fire, then puts noble gases in said tubes to create what we call NEON. Fun fact: did you know Neon is just the name-sake of the medium. There are 4 other noble gases that burn different colors and brilliances also used in creating Neon work (most commonly Argon) which burns a light blue.

Isn’t LED more efficient, more durable, more eco friendly?

NO (except for durable, sure you can drop your LED on the floor. Have a good time with that). Neon is just as, and in many cases more, efficient than LED. It’s true that LED is more efficient than incandescent bulbs, but it is not the case with Neon.

The largest neon power source (called a transformer) delivers 15,000 volts to the sign but only draws 3.7 amps from the wall. This is pretty dang efficient.

LED, a plastic product that contains Arsenic and Lead, will never be more eco-friendly than Neon, a glass product that optionally contains a very small ball of Mercury, smaller than the size of a pea. You do not need to use Mercury if you do not wish and the Noble gas inside the glass is called “noble” for a reason - it is inert, non reactive and perfectly safe to breathe. In fact, it’s in the atmosphere. Neon will last, theoretically, decades so it sure beats plastic that lasts an average of 3 years and sits in a landfill.
